How to Maximize Space in a Small Bedroom with Furniture Arrangement

When it comes to small bedrooms, space is a valuable commodity. Therefore, it’s essential to make the most of every inch. One way to do this is by choosing furniture pieces that serve multiple purposes. For example, a storage ottoman can double as a seat and a place to store extra blankets or pillows. A bed with built-in drawers or a storage headboard can also provide additional storage without taking up extra space.

Creative Furniture Arrangement for a Small Bedroom

Don’t be afraid to think outside the box when arranging furniture in a small bedroom. Instead of placing your bed against a wall, try positioning it diagonally in a corner. This can create a sense of space and add visual interest to the room. You can also utilize vertical space by installing shelves or hanging organizers on the walls to store items such as books, jewelry, or small decor pieces.

Big Furniture Solutions for Small Bedrooms

Contrary to popular belief, big furniture can work in a small bedroom. The key is to choose the right pieces and arrange them strategically. For example, a tall and narrow dresser can provide ample storage without taking up too much floor space. A large mirror positioned on a wall can also make the room feel bigger and reflect light, making the space appear brighter and more open.

Space-Saving Bedroom Furniture Arrangement Tips

When working with a small bedroom, it’s crucial to maximize every inch of space. Consider using furniture that can be folded or collapsed when not in use, such as a wall-mounted desk or a drop-leaf table. You can also opt for furniture with a smaller footprint, such as a slim nightstand or a narrow dresser, to save space while still providing functionality.

Small Bedroom Furniture Layout Ideas

The layout of furniture in a small bedroom can make all the difference in how the space looks and feels. For a balanced and visually appealing layout, start by placing the bed against the longest wall in the room. Then, position other furniture, such as a dresser or a desk, on the opposite wall to create a sense of symmetry. You can also try floating furniture in the room, such as a bed or a desk, to create more floor space.

Small Bedroom Furniture Placement Ideas

When it comes to small bedrooms, every piece of furniture matters. Therefore, it’s essential to place each piece in the right spot. Avoid placing furniture in front of windows or doors, as this can make the room feel cramped and hinder natural light. Instead, try to place furniture against walls or in corners to open up the space and create a better flow.
